2. Gear

The efficacy of “rim straightening close to me” hinges considerably on the standard and kind of apparatus utilized. The presence of specialised equipment immediately impacts the precision and sturdiness of the restore, differentiating between a brief repair and an enduring answer.

  • Hydraulic Press Programs

    Hydraulic press techniques are elementary for making use of managed drive to bend the rim again into its authentic form. These techniques permit for exact changes and forestall additional injury in the course of the straightening course of. An instance is a multi-ton press with varied attachments tailor-made to completely different rim profiles. Improper tools might end in cracks or structural weaknesses, compromising the integrity of the wheel.

  • Dial Indicators and Measuring Instruments

    Dial indicators and precision measuring instruments are important for assessing the extent of the injury and verifying the accuracy of the restore. These devices present exact measurements of runout (radial and lateral deviation) to make sure the rim meets specified tolerances. An absence of correct measuring instruments can result in imbalances, vibrations, and untimely tire put on following the straightening process.

  • Heating Gear

    Managed heating tools, corresponding to induction heaters, is typically employed to enhance the malleability of the metallic and facilitate the straightening course of. This minimizes the danger of cracking or weakening the rim throughout deformation. Improper or extreme heating, nevertheless, can alter the metallic’s properties, making the rim brittle and liable to failure. Subsequently, exact temperature management is crucial.

  • Welding Gear (When Relevant)

    In circumstances the place the rim has cracks or important injury, welding tools could also be essential to restore the structural integrity of the wheel. The usage of acceptable welding methods and supplies is essential for guaranteeing a robust and sturdy restore. Insufficient welding can result in structural failure and pose a severe security threat. The presence of licensed welders and acceptable tools ensures correct execution.

These sides exhibit that the seek for “rim straightening close to me” should think about the obtainable tools. A supplier’s funding within the right instruments immediately displays their dedication to high quality and the probability of a profitable, long-lasting rim restore. The absence of those specialised instruments will increase the danger of a substandard restore, probably compromising car security and efficiency.

3. Experience

The relevance of experience to the search “rim straightening close to me” can’t be overstated. The profitable restoration of a broken wheel rim calls for specialised data and proficiency, immediately influencing the security and efficiency of the car. The next sides element the crucial elements of this experience.

  • Harm Evaluation Proficiency

    Correct analysis of rim injury is paramount. A technician should differentiate between superficial bends, structural cracks, and irreparable deformities. For example, a seemingly minor bend would possibly conceal underlying structural weaknesses. Incorrect evaluation can result in insufficient restore, probably inflicting wheel failure at excessive speeds. An professional technician will make use of visible inspection, specialised instruments, and materials data to find out the suitable plan of action. Misdiagnosis ends in compromised structural integrity.

  • Metallurgical Understanding

    Wheel rims are constructed from varied alloys, every possessing distinct properties and responses to warmth and stress. A technician should perceive these metallurgical nuances to pick out the suitable straightening methods and welding procedures (if required). For example, heating aluminum rims past a crucial temperature can weaken the metallic. Experience includes understanding the composition of the rim and using strategies that protect its power. This prevents embrittlement or cracking in the course of the restore course of.

  • Straightening Approach Mastery

    A number of rim straightening methods exist, starting from hydraulic urgent to localized heating. The selection of method depends upon the sort and extent of the injury. An skilled technician will possess mastery over these methods, deciding on essentially the most acceptable methodology to revive the rim’s authentic form with out inducing additional stress or weakening the fabric. Improper method can exacerbate injury, rendering the rim unusable. The experience required to keep away from such outcomes is just not obtained rapidly or simply.

  • Welding Ability (If Relevant)

    When cracks or structural injury necessitate welding, the technician’s ability turns into critically necessary. Welding have to be carried out by licensed professionals utilizing acceptable tools and methods to make sure a robust and sturdy bond. Improper welding can create weak factors within the rim, resulting in catastrophic failure. Experience encompasses deciding on the proper welding rod, controlling warmth enter, and guaranteeing correct penetration. The long-term security and reliability of the repaired rim rely closely on welding experience.

5. Price

The financial facet is intrinsically linked to the seek for “rim straightening close to me.” People requiring this service invariably think about the monetary implications alongside elements corresponding to proximity and experience. The whole expenditure is influenced by a number of variables, warranting an in depth examination.

  • Extent of Harm

    The severity and kind of injury immediately have an effect on the fee. A minor bend usually necessitates much less labor and specialised methods in comparison with a severely cracked or deformed rim. For example, a easy dent would possibly require solely straightening, whereas a cracked rim necessitates welding and probably refinishing, rising the general expense. Subsequently, the preliminary evaluation of injury is essential in figuring out the restore price.

  • Rim Materials and Building

    The fabric composition and development of the rim play a big function in pricing. Aluminum alloy rims usually require extra specialised methods and tools in comparison with metal rims, probably rising labor prices. Moreover, advanced designs or multi-piece rims might demand extra time and experience, additional influencing the whole expenditure. Sure unique supplies might additionally inflate the fee as a result of rarity of the instruments wanted to deal with them.

  • Labor Charges

    Native labor charges differ considerably relying on geographic location and the supplier’s overhead. Companies in metropolitan areas usually cost larger hourly charges in comparison with these in rural settings. Furthermore, outlets with licensed technicians and superior tools might command premium costs. Subsequently, evaluating quotes from a number of suppliers is crucial to establish aggressive pricing inside the “rim straightening close to me” search radius.

  • Further Companies

    The ultimate price might embody supplementary companies past the core rim straightening process. These would possibly embrace tire removing and reinstallation, balancing, and refinishing. A buyer searching for “rim straightening close to me” ought to make clear whether or not the quoted worth contains these ancillary companies to keep away from sudden prices. Failure to account for these additions can result in price range overruns and dissatisfaction.

In summation, the fee related to “rim straightening close to me” is a multifaceted consideration. People should account for the injury severity, rim materials, native labor charges, and any supplementary companies to precisely assess the general monetary dedication. An intensive analysis of those elements ensures a clear and knowledgeable decision-making course of when deciding on a rim straightening supplier.

Steadily Requested Questions About Rim Straightening

The next addresses frequent inquiries and issues concerning the method of rim straightening, offering detailed and informative solutions.

Query 1: Is rim straightening a secure and dependable restore methodology?

Rim straightening, when carried out by certified technicians utilizing acceptable tools, is a secure and dependable restore methodology for sure kinds of rim injury. The method restores the wheel’s authentic geometry, guaranteeing correct tire seating and stability. Nonetheless, severely broken rims with cracks or important materials loss might not be appropriate for straightening and should require alternative.

Query 2: What kinds of rim injury will be repaired by way of straightening?

Straightening is usually efficient for repairing bends, dents, and minor deformations ensuing from impacts with potholes, curbs, or different highway hazards. The method can handle each radial and lateral runout, restoring the rim’s roundness and stopping vibrations. Important cracks, fractures, or materials corrosion might preclude profitable straightening.

Query 3: How can the standard of rim straightening service be evaluated?

The standard of service will be assessed by contemplating the supplier’s expertise, tools, status, and guarantee coverage. A good supplier will possess licensed technicians, make the most of specialised equipment, and provide a guaranty overlaying defects in workmanship. On-line opinions and referrals can present helpful insights into the supplier’s service high quality and buyer satisfaction.

Query 4: Does straightening have an effect on the structural integrity of the rim?

If carried out appropriately, straightening mustn’t considerably compromise the structural integrity of the rim. Nonetheless, extreme drive or improper heating can weaken the metallic, probably resulting in future failures. Expert technicians will fastidiously management the method to attenuate stress and protect the rim’s power. A correct injury evaluation will decide if straightening is a secure possibility.

Query 5: How lengthy does rim straightening usually take?

The turnaround time for rim straightening varies relying on the extent of the injury and the supplier’s workload. Minor bends could also be repaired inside a couple of hours, whereas extra advanced injury requiring welding or refinishing can take one to 2 days. Respected outlets will present an estimate of the turnaround time primarily based on an intensive inspection of the rim.

Query 6: What’s the price of rim straightening in comparison with rim alternative?

Rim straightening is mostly less expensive than rim alternative, notably for alloy wheels. The price of straightening usually ranges from a fraction to half the worth of a brand new rim, making it a pretty possibility for budget-conscious car house owners. Nonetheless, severely broken rims might necessitate alternative on account of security issues.
